Around Belt ...

The largest community within a 50 mile [80 km] radius is Great Falls. It is located about 18 miles [28 km] to the northwest of Belt. Great Falls has a population of 58,400 people.<1>.

For comparison, Belt has a population of 570 people.

Cascade County ...

Belt is located in Cascade County<4>.

The following coun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Cascade County: Chouteau, Judith Basin, Lewis and Clark, Meagher & Teton.
